Pengaruh Konsentrasi Awal Larutan Ion Logam Cd2+ terhadap Penyerapan Biomassa Kulit Langsat (Lansium domesticum) yang Dimodifikasi Metanol

Abstract

Industrial activities have been growing rapidly lately. Increased industrial activity can improve the quality of human life, but behind it there are adverse effects on the environment and human health. There are many harmful heavy metals found in industrial waste. One of them is cadmium metal, which is one of the dangerous heavy metals that if accumulated in the body can threaten human health. Langsat fruit peel waste can be utilized as an adsorbent. Adsorbent is an absorbent substance/material to absorb heavy metal ions. Biomass was characterized using AAS instrument to determine the concentration of Cd2+ metal ion absorption in langsat peel biomass. This study was conducted to determine the effect of the initial concentration of solution on the absorption of Cd2+ metal ions in methanol-modified langsat peel biomass. The results showed that the optimal absorption of Cd2+ metal ions in methanol-modified langsat peel biomass was at a concentration of 400 mg/L with an absorption capacity of 9.387 mg/g.
